On Episode 33 of the Metal From The Inside Podcast, original bass player for the Alice Cooper Group, and Rock And Roll Hall Of Fame inductee, Dennis Dunaway calls in! Sydney and Dennis sit down to discuss @alicecooper’s brand new record ‘Detroit Stories’ (out NOW!) featuring the original Alice Cooper Group, the process behind writing and recording brand new tracks on the record such as “I Hate You” and “Social Debris”, his days in the Alice Cooper Group and how his animosity revolving the band's break-up in the mid-1970s evolved, his short film 'Cold Cold Coffin' co-starring @calicocooper, playing Sweden Rock Festival 2019 with his current musical project Blue Coupe, and a whole lot more! 👁‍🗨👁‍🗨

On Episode 32 of the Metal From The Inside Podcast, highly esteemed hard rock and heavy metal photographer, @markweissguy, calls in to discuss his first photo book released in June of 2020: ‘The Decade That Rocked.’ After getting his start by sneaking his camera into live shows in the late ‘70s (shooting bands like KISS, Aerosmith, and Alice Cooper), Mark become the mainstay photographer at Circus Magazine and went on to shoot legendary rock acts ranging from Van Halen to Ozzy Osbourne, and every band in-between. In this week's episode, @sydneyannataylor and Mark sit down to chat all things 'The Decade That Rocked' as well as the beginnings of Mark's love for music, the stories behind album covers such as Yngwie J Malmsteen's Rising Force 'Odyssey' and Cinderella's 'Night Songs', shooting @dokken_official on 'American Bandstand', working with the often-overlooked hard rock group Badlands, how he managed to adapt his craft during the genre shift of the early to mid-'90s, and as always, so much more. 📸🔥
